Deanna Richardson from Richardson Accounting and Consulting, PLLC @ theCPA-4U.com asked
“Have you heard of Digit? Seems like a great way to build up an emergency fund and....it says it is free. Then their are bonuses for keeping $100 in it over 3 months. If I did my math right, the bonuses are over 2.5% interest (5 cents / week per $100). Would love to hear what you think.”
I tackle these new fractional, or automatic, savings accounts: Acorns, Digit and Betterment’s SmartDollar
